Computer Information Systems is one of the most popular majors in the nation, ranking 9th of all the majors we analyze. In 2020-2021, 88,434 degrees were awarded to students with this major. In 2019-2020, computer information systems gra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$54,066 and had an average of $26,787 in loans still to pay off.

Across Missouri, there were 1,495 computer information systems graduates with average earnings and debt of $56,012 and $33,735 respectively.

This year’s “Best Value CIS Schools in Missouri” ranking looked at 14 colleges that offer degrees in a bachelor’s in computer information systems. This ranking identifies schools with high-quality computer information systems programs that also have a lower cost than schools of similar quality.

To come up with these rankings, we looked at factors such as the cost to attend the school after aid is awarded and overall quality of the computer information systems program at the school. Check out our ranking methodology for more information.
